    Losing "PMB" (postal mail box) info when running AddressAccelerator from Data Health Center

    Has anyone else seen this occur?  I'm not sure if I know how to prevent it from happening again - I'm having a hard time figuring out how to query those records beforehand, so I can restore them after I've run AddressAccelerator.

    What's happening is that for addresses that are not PO Boxes (it's only allowed to be called a PO Box if it's at a US Post Office) - the PMB and the number of the box are being stripped from the street address - but it only happens when I run AddressAccelerator from the Data Health Center.  I tested it on two addresses in the system I know that have this situation, and using the F8 key on the record itself does NOT cause this to happen.

     The consequence is, that unless you save all your old addresses, or have done something with the ones it might impact in advance so you can fix them afterward, those addresses become incomplete because the box number is lost.

    For instance:

    1314-B Center Dr #100  will F8 validate without change, but after I run the full validation, it reads as "1314 Center Dr Unit B" which is clearly not going to reach my constituent unless there are very few boxes at that UPS or other Mailboxes Etc. -type store.

    Has anyone seen this to occur, and if so, what have you done about it?
